Job Summary

  • Creates and manages provider’s surgery/hospital procedure schedules, maintaining any changes, cancellations, rescheduling and/or clinical follow up.
  • Obtains authorization for surgeries/hospital procedures by researching coverage and obtaining prior authorization, verifying eligibility and benefits.
  • Meets with surgery/procedure patients to explain the process, including pre-op labs, tests, or any pre-requisite that needs prior attention.

Key Requirements

  • Two years of medical registration, billing, collection, scheduling, or insurance experience
  • Two years of customer service experience
  • Working knowledge of word processing, spreadsheet, email, and calendaring programs
  • Two years at Intermountain Health as a PSR, MA or similar position
  • Two years of experience working with patient access or extensive knowledge in health insurance industry
